Uncrustify is a source code beautifier that allows you to banish crusty code. It works with C, C++, C#, D, Java, and Pawn and indents (with spaces only, tabs and spaces, and tabs only), adds and removes newlines, has a high degree of control over operator spacing, aligns code, is extremely configurable, and is easy to modify.
| Tags | Software Development |
|---|---|
| Licenses | GPL |
| Operating Systems | OS Independent |
| Implementation | C C# C++ Java |
Recent releases


Changes: This version has more bugfixes and a few new features.


Changes: Many new options were added and many bugs were fixed.


No changes have been submitted for this release.


Changes: This release adds simple Embedded SQL support and fixes many bugs.


Changes: A few D-related bugs were fixed. Some more options were included and the config file documentation was improved.